Isaiah 1:27-29
King James Version
27 Zion shall be redeemed with judgment, and her converts with righteousness.
28 And the destruction of the transgressors and of the sinners shall be together, and they that forsake the Lord shall be consumed.
29 For they shall be ashamed of the oaks which ye have desired, and ye shall be confounded for the gardens that ye have chosen.

Isaiah 1:27-29
New King James Version
27 Zion shall be redeemed with justice,
And her [a]penitents with righteousness.
28 The (A)destruction of transgressors and of sinners shall be together,
And those who forsake the Lord shall be consumed.
29 For [b]they shall be ashamed of the [c]terebinth trees
Which you have desired;
And you shall be embarrassed because of the gardens
Which you have chosen.
Footnotes
- Isaiah 1:27 Lit. returners
- Isaiah 1:29 So with MT, LXX, Vg.; some Heb. mss., Tg. you
- Isaiah 1:29 Sites of pagan worship
